What does 'working at' mean in a job context?

'Working at' generally refers to being employed by a particular company or organization. It encompasses your role, responsibilities, and daily experiences as a member of that workplace. People often use this phrase when describing their job or sharing insights about an employer, workplace culture, or specific job functions. Understanding what it's like to work at a certain company can help job seekers determine if it's a good fit for their career goals.

What are some common challenges employees face when adjusting to a new workplace environment?

When starting at a new company, employees often face challenges such as adapting to the organization's culture, learning new processes, and building relationships with team members. It can also take time to understand communication styles and performance expectations unique to the workplace. Proactively engaging in team meetings, seeking feedback, and participating in onboarding activities can help ease the transition and promote a smoother integration into the work environment.

Corrocoat USA specializes in manufacture and application of corrosion resistant specialty industrial coatings, linings and composites. Approximately 90% of the work occurs on heavy industrial plant sites, 10% of work in a shop atmosphere. We’re expanding our fiberglass repair and installation capabilities and seek an experienced Working Foreman to lead projects and hands-on work.
Role Overview As a Working Foreman, you will lead small crews on fiberglass installation, repair, and composite projects while actively participating in the work. You’ll ensure high-quality, safe, and efficient execution on industrial and marine assets (e.g., tanks, pipes, pumps, structures, vessels). This is a hands-on leadership position for someone who thrives in challenging environments.
Key Responsibilities
  • Lead and mentor installation/repair crews on-site and in-shop.
  • Perform and oversee fiberglass lay-up, laminating, grinding, fairing, bonding, and composite repairs using resins, glass flake, and related materials.
  • Prepare surfaces (blasting, sanding, etc.), apply protective coatings/composites, and ensure compliance with project specs and quality standards.
  • Manage project timelines, safety protocols, and crew productivity.
  • Troubleshoot issues, maintain tools/equipment, and coordinate with clients/project managers.
  • Conduct inspections and contribute to continuous improvement in processes.
  • Travel to project sites as needed (local/regional focus).
Requirements
  • 5+ years of hands-on experience in fiberglass/composites installation and repair, preferably in marine or heavy industrial settings.
  • Proven leadership/foreman experience (leading small teams).
  • Strong knowledge of resins, gelcoats, fiberglass matting, safety practices (OSHA, confined space, etc.), and quality control.
  • Ability to read blueprints/specs and work in physically demanding conditions (heights, confined spaces, outdoors).
  • Valid driver’s license and reliable transportation; willingness to travel.
  • Relevant certifications (e.g., AMPP/NACE, composites, or safety) a plus.
